Motocross rider injured at North American International Motorcycle Supershow

Christian Martinez Hospitalized After Motocross Jump at North American International Motorcycle Supershow

Christian Martinez, a skilled motocross rider participating in the North American International Motorcycle Supershow in Mississauga, was rushed to the hospital following a daring jump during the event, as reported by a source to CP24.

PR representative Colleen McCourt, while unable to disclose Martinez’s specific condition, assured CP24 that he was “alert and conscious” when emergency services transported him to the hospital.

Peel Regional Police responded to a single-vehicle collision at the intersection of Airport Road and Derry Road East just before 12:30 p.m. The incident occurred near The International Centre, the venue hosting the 49th annual motorcycle show.

Martinez, with a background in dirt bike riding since the age of 14, has been showcasing his jumping skills since 2007 and delving into freestyle motocross (FMX) tricks since 2015, as detailed on his website.
